Verisign Reports Mixed Q1 Earnings, Raises Dividend

Verisign, Inc. reported its quarterly earnings, with an EPS of $2.23, missing analyst estimates by $0.06, but revenue of $425.3 million slightly beat consensus and was up 7.6% year-over-year. The company also announced an increase in its quarterly dividend to $0.81 per share. Following the earnings, Verisign's EVP, Thomas Indelicarto, sold 498 shares under a pre-arranged trading plan. Several brokerages, including Weiss Ratings, Zacks Investment Research, Citigroup, and JPMorgan Chase, issued updated ratings and price targets, mostly with positive or neutral sentiments. Institutional investors like Advisors Asset Management Inc., Integrated Wealth Concepts LLC, NewEdge Advisors LLC, Jones Financial Companies Lllp, and Empowered Funds LLC have increased their holdings in Verisign, reflecting growing interest in the information services provider.
